Glaucoma Tube - Consent & Care

This video outlines pre-operative care and patient preparation for a glaucoma drainage tube procedure, addressing issues like ocular surface health and the management of anticoagulant medications. It then details the consent process, emphasizing clear communication about the diagnosis, the surgery's purpose in lowering intraocular pressure without restoring lost vision, and describing the mechanics of the implant. The document thoroughly explains the benefits of the surgery, primarily focusing on pressure reduction and slowing vision loss, alongside various ways to post-operatively manage eye pressure. Crucially, it enumerates both early and late potential risks and complications associated with the procedure, ranging from bleeding and infection to scarring and potential failure of the implant. Finally, it covers essential post-operative instructions and expectations, including follow-up visit frequency, symptom management, activity restrictions, and the timeline for visual recovery.
